Resumo(s): | An adaptive serious game on Statistics is being under development in the framework of higher education. The main objective of this serious game is to promote and explain the applicability of statistics concepts in day-To-day life and in the decision-making process. The present work stresses the project development and mechanisms including the storyboard and game scenarios. The storyboard is based on a mystery where the clues and answers are defined in terms of statistics knowledge (probabilities, confidence intervals, hypotheses tests). The game scenarios were developed using open source tools and using as reference scenario the university campus. By doing this, the student/player are integrated in a "familiar" environment. It is expected to increase the students' proficiency on Statistics. |
